Target Information

Pireta is an innovative company specializing in smart textiles, having been founded in 2017 to commercialize a patented technology developed at the National Physical Laboratory (NPL). The company was established by Dr. Chris Hunt, who invented a unique additive process that allows for the application of conductivity to various types of fabrics without compromising their handle or drape. Operating from NPL's Teddington campus in the UK, Pireta has positioned itself at the forefront of advancements in wearable technology.

The company has developed a proprietary additive process that enhances the conductivity of fabrics at any stage of production—ranging from yarn to finished garments. This technology promises to deliver superior levels of conductivity while maintaining the performance characteristics of the garments.

Rationale Behind the Deal

The investment by the UK Innovation & Science Seed Fund (UKI2S) into Pireta is aimed at nurturing the company's innovative technology and accelerating the pursuit of commercial opportunities. This initial funding will allow Pireta to optimize its core technology further, potentially leading to the development of new applications that could set the standard in the smart textiles arena.

By investing in Pireta, UKI2S seeks to facilitate the entry of pioneering wearable technology into the market, which aligns with the broader trend of integrating more advanced and discreet devices into everyday clothing.
